<div>thanks to the use of the extrapolated multi-constellation orbits recently provided by GFZ,</div>
<div>the CNES real-time analysis center now provides State Space Representation for Beidou.</div>
<div>These new products are available via the CLK93 stream.</div>
<div> </div>
<div>The CLK93 stream now contains the following RTCM messages:</div>
<div> </div>
<div>GPS Orbits, Clocks, Code biases ( 5 sec): 1060, 1059</div>
<div>Glonass Orbits, Clocks, Code biases ( 5 sec): 1066, 1065</div>
<div>Galileo Orbits, Clocks, Code biases ( 5 sec): 1243, 1242</div>
<div>Beidou Orbits, Clocks ( 5 sec): 1261</div>
<div>GPS phase biases for AR (L1, L2, L5) ( 5 sec): 1265</div>
<div>Ionosphere VTEC (60 sec): 1264</div>

<div>The characteristics of the CNES real-time solutions are the following:</div>
<div> </div>
<div>Constellation Orbit error UERE STREAMS AR</div>
<div> (median cm) (cm)</div>
<div>GPS 3 1 CLK91,CLK93 YES</div>
<div>Glonass 5 2 CLK91,CLK93 NO</div>
<div>Galileo 40 10 CLK91 NO</div>
<div>Beidou (MEO, IGSO) 15 5 CLK91 NO</div>
<div>Beidou (GEO) 800 TBD CLK91 NO</div>
<div> </div>
<div>Beidou corrections are defined over the broadcast available at the mountpoint RTCM3EPH-MGEX at the mgex.igs-ip.net caster.</div>
<div>They are computed thanks to the latest version of BNC (available at the BKG SVN repository).</div>
